Material Exchange is a sourcing platform that structures early-stage sourcing workflows for product development teams, backed by Partech. It provides a structured, agentic environment - with an AI assistant named Frank - to define sourcing direction, align stakeholders, and coordinate sourcing earlier in product development. The platform helps teams structure briefs, identify relevant suppliers and materials, surface missing cost or compliance data, compare options, and flag gaps before decisions move downstream. No public API, developer portal, SDKs, or documentation surface has been found; this profile was enriched via domain-security probes and public identity discovery only.
